Ann Morgan & Nicholas Murray

A fairytale

Ann Morgan explodes some publishing myths, and Nicholas Murray considers a curious reluctance. Ann Morgan retells the grand old myth about becoming a published author, then takes her editorial red pen to all of its inaccuracies. Nicholas Murray dissects his own reluctance to call himself a writer, after an early career in journalism and despite having subsequently published more than twenty books in a huge variety of genres.
